UAV aerial survey refers to the use of unmanned aerial vehicles, commonly known as drones, to capture aerial data for mapping, land surveying, agriculture, infrastructure inspection, and more. UAVs equipped with specialized cameras and sensors can efficiently gather high-resolution imagery and valuable information from the sky.
One of the main advantages of UAV aerial survey is the ability to collect data in a fast, safe, and cost-effective manner. Drones can access hard-to-reach areas, reduce human risk, and capture detailed images for various applications such as monitoring crop health, assessing construction sites, and creating 3D models.
UAV aerial survey has diverse applications across industries. In agriculture, drones are used for crop monitoring, soil analysis, and field mapping. In construction, they help with site planning, progress tracking, and infrastructure inspection. Additionally, UAVs are employed in environmental monitoring, disaster response, and wildlife conservation.
When selecting a drone for aerial survey, consider factors such as flight time, camera quality, payload capacity, GPS accuracy, and software compatibility. Popular drones for surveying include DJI Phantom 4 RTK, senseFly eBee X, and Parrot Anafi USA, each offering unique features suited for different surveying needs.
Before conducting UAV aerial surveys, it is essential to be aware of local aviation regulations regarding drone operations. Adhering to safety guidelines, obtaining necessary permits, and following ethical practices are crucial for successful and legal aerial survey missions.
